Light Buttermilk Pralines

ingredients
- 1 1⁄2 cups sugar
- 1⁄2 cup fat-free buttermilk
- 1 1⁄2 tablespoons light corn syrup
- 1⁄2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 dash salt
- 2⁄3 cup roasted pecan
- 1 1⁄2 teaspoons light butter
- 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
directions
- Combine first 5 ingredients in a large saucepan. Cook over low heat until sugar dissolves, stirring constantly. Continue cooking over low heat until a candy thermometer registers 234° or about 10-15 minutes stirring occasionally. Remove from heat; let stand 5 minutes.
- Stir in nuts, butter, and vanilla; beat with a wooden spoon until mixture begins to lose its shine (about 5-10 minutes). Drop by teaspoonfuls onto wax paper. Let stand 20 minutes or until set.
